Arnie double but Wilshere catches the eye

Preston North End 2 Irons 2

Marko Arnautovic and Jack Wilshere were impressive as the Hammers earned a 2-2 draw against Preston North End this afternoon.Arnie gave the Irons a 2-1 interval lead with a couple of typical efforts but too Wilshere looked business as he completed his first 45 minutes which was always the plan and won a free kick which led to the Hammer of last season’s opener.

The former Arsenal man constantly caught the eye but just as was the case at Wycombe Wanderers last weekend it was top man Arnie who scored.

New signing  Andriy Yarmolenko looked a star in the making and it was the Ukranian who provided the assist for Arnie’s second. right on half time.

Preston had equalised after Arnie’s first through a  Tom Clarke’s powerful header, and Billy Bodin got their second to ensure honours were split at the end.

Wilshere, having been fouled inside the Preston half, allowed Mark Noble to float a free kick to Arnautovic who controlled and shot under Chris Maxwell.

After that the Hammers started to play some good stuff with Yarmelenko combining with Wilshere and Ryan Fredericks.
